Our ancestors were always active: if they weren’t hunting or gathering, they were fighting or making love. A lot of their time was spent slowly moving around with occasional periods of sprinting. Life back then sure was dangerous and often short, but they were all in good shape. However, the way we live our lives today has changed. Many of us spend a good part of our workdays sitting down, and that’s before we deal with all other responsibilities like shopping and taking care of our loved ones. When we finally get a little time for ourselves, we’re often too tired to do any serious exercise even if we’ve slowly been gaining weight for a while. The good news is that, when it comes to maintaining our weight or even losing it, the way we eat is a lot more important than exercise. Here are a few tips to help you keep your current weight: – Avoid simple carbohydrates like bread, potato, and pasta. These may be tasty, but will spike your blood sugar and make you crave food again in a few hours, making you eat even more calories. Instead, eat more fruit, berries, and nuts. These are all delicious and provide a great alternative. – Have some fat with your food. While high in calories, adding a bit of butter to your meals will make you feel seated for a longer time, so you won’t feel the need to eat again so soon. Try it for yourself! – Make sure you get enough sleep. Hunger can sometimes be increased by a lack of sleep, so be sure to get plenty. – Drink enough liquid. Another reason for sudden hunger pangs can be dehydration.
